A woman was remanded in custody at Newry and Mourne Magistrates' Court yesterday on a charge linked to Tuesday's failed mortar-bomb attack on a police station in Newry. Ms Margaret Blair (41), from Parkhead Crescent, Newry, Co Down, is accused of unlawfully and maliciously conspiring with a person or persons unknown to cause an explosion likely to cause injury or serious damage to property. Ms Blair denied any involvement. She was remanded in custody to appear at Newry Court House on July 29th.
